An Executive Certificate in Renewable Energy Enforcement Policy is increasingly significant in the UK's rapidly evolving energy landscape. The UK government aims for net-zero emissions by 2050, driving substantial investment and regulatory changes in renewable energy sources. This necessitates professionals equipped to navigate complex policy frameworks and enforcement procedures. According to government data, renewable energy sources contributed 43% to the UK's electricity generation in 2022, a significant rise from previous years. This growth underscores the urgent need for expertise in renewable energy enforcement, ensuring compliance and sustainable industry development.
